EDUCATORS BRING GOVERNMENT TO THE TABLE TO BARGAIN
Today’s Multi Employer Bargaining meeting for early childhood educators will be joined by Federal Government representatives for the first time in history.

UWU’s Helen Gibbons says the primary issue “driving educators to leave a sector they love” is pay.
“Love doesn’t pay the bills and educators consistently tell us they can’t afford to work in a sector that pays them so poorly."
